Transaction 66721e143c340c72e09d9c93cbe9650f139364c25c368776aff17c7386cedfcc
1 Input
1 Output
-
66721e143c340c72e09d9c93cbe9650f139364c25c368776aff17c7386cedfcc:0
- value
- 389155
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 674d82b6b1c541d6f968923c2c280df6ff59901f OP_EQUAL
- address
- 3B7ENqH9d7baw9CWx5Vf1uV8tgsDgA1jfB